Care instructions for your jewelry

Our jewelry pieces accompany you through everyday life, on travels, and during special moments. To ensure you enjoy your favorite piece for a long time, here you will find information on the materials used and their care.

Waxed Polyester Yarn

For many of our macrame jewelry pieces, trenzas, anklets, and chokers, we use high-quality waxed polyester yarn.

This material is particularly durable, water-repellent, and suitable for everyday use. It remains beautiful for a long time even with regular wear and is excellently suited for jewelry pieces that can accompany you every day.

Care

  • Waterproof and water-repellent

  • Can be worn in everyday life without problems

  • Clean with a little water and mild soap if necessary

  • Then air dry

Due to sunlight, water, friction, and daily wear, the yarn may soften slightly or lose some color over time. This is part of the natural development of a worn piece of jewelry.

Brass

Brass captivates with its warm gold tone and natural radiance. Our brass jewelry pieces contain only 0.006% nickel, which is significantly below the EU limit.

Brass is a living material and may darken slightly over time or develop a natural patina. This is not a defect but part of its character.

Care

Brass is easy to clean:

  • Polish with a paste of flour, salt, and vinegar

  • Then rinse with water and a little soap

  • Dry with a soft cloth

For some people, brass, especially in rings, can occasionally leave greenish marks on the skin. This depends on individual factors such as skin type, sweat, or cosmetic products and is harmless to health.

We love brass for its warm gold tone, its naturalness, and its fair price-performance ratio.

Gold-plated Brass

For our gold-plated jewelry pieces, brass forms the base. Depending on the piece of jewelry, the material is either directly gold-plated or first refined with a thin layer of silver and then gold-plated with 24-carat gold. This creates the warm gold tone that makes our gold-plated designs so special.

The gold plating gives the jewelry its elegant appearance and beautifully showcases natural stones, symbols, and fine details.

Care

To ensure the gold plating remains beautiful for as long as possible, we recommend:

  • Removing jewelry before showering, bathing, and swimming

  • Avoiding direct contact with perfume, sunscreen, and cosmetics

  • Storing jewelry dry and protected

  • Cleaning with a soft cloth

Over time, the gold plating may become a little duller. This natural aging process is part of the life of a worn piece of jewelry.

Sterling Silver 925

Sterling silver consists of 92.5% pure silver and is one of the most popular jewelry materials ever. It is timeless, durable, and versatile.

Care

Silver can react with oxygen and darken over time. This is completely normal.

Suitable for cleaning are:

  • A silver polishing cloth

  • A silver dip

  • A special silver cleaner

After cleaning, silver regains its original shine.

Silver Plated

Silver-plated jewelry has a fine silver-toned finish that gives it a cool, timeless shine. Depending on the piece, different base materials may be used.

The silver-plated finish beautifully highlights natural stones, special textures and delicate details and gives the jewelry its characteristic silver appearance.

Care

To keep the silver-plated surface beautiful for as long as possible, we recommend:

  • Avoiding contact with perfume, creams and cosmetics whenever possible
  • Removing jewelry before showering, bathing or swimming
  • Avoiding contact with chlorine and salt water
  • Storing jewelry in a dry and protected place
  • Gently wiping the surface with a soft, dry cloth when needed

Please do not use aggressive cleaning products or abrasive silver polishing cloths, as these may damage the silver-plated surface.

Over time, the silver plating may change slightly through skin contact, moisture and friction. This natural aging process is part of the life of a worn piece of jewelry.

Stainless Steel

Stainless steel is particularly robust, easy to care for, and waterproof. Many of our chains, clasps, and connecting elements are made of high-quality stainless steel.

The material is hypoallergenic, does not tarnish, and is excellently suited for daily use. Especially for people with sensitive skin, stainless steel is a popular and uncomplicated choice.

Care

  • Waterproof and suitable for everyday use

  • Clean with water and a soft cloth

  • Use a little mild soap if necessary

  • Then polish dry
